The problem is with my checkbox button. The script I used is: Checkbox Button Column Behavior- getProp dgDataControl return the long id of me end dgDataControl on mouseDown pMouseBtnNum dgMouseDown pMouseBtnNum setDataOfIndex the dgHilitedIndexes of me, the dgColumn of the target, (the hilited of target) end mouseDown There are two problems. The first is that when I look at the data in the Data Grid after highlighting the checkbox, the data from the datagrid reports that the hilite is 'false." If I uncheck the checkbox, and grab the data again, the Data Grid reports that the hilite is 'true." It is reversed from what is normal. Second problem is that if I click in the column with the check box, missing the button, I get an error stating that the (column) does not have that property (assume it means the hilite property). I attempted to put an: if the pMouseBtnNum is 1then setDataOfIndex the dgHilitedIndexes of me, the dgColumn of the target, (the hilited of target) But that still did not take out the error message when I clicked on the column instead of the checkbox.
